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Broad-leaf mullein | Little Black Serotine |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Lamiales (Lamiales) | Chiroptera (Bats) |
| Family | Scrophulariaceae | Vespertilionidae |
| Genus | Verbascum | Eptesicus |
| Species | Verbascum pulverulentum | Eptesicus andinus |
